In contrast to traditional Western ceremonies, which are typically a single-day event, South Asian weddings are usually multi-day festivities involving a series of traditions, family gatherings, and lavish receptions. Each of these events carries significant cultural meaning, making it crucial to work with a photographer who is familiar with these customs.
Here’s why selecting an experienced Asian wedding photographer is important:
1. Understanding of Cultural Traditions
South Asian weddings involve a variety of traditions and rituals, each requiring specific attention. For instance:
Hindu Weddings: The Haldi, Henna Night, Sangeet, and the official nuptials all have distinct traditions that should be captured.
Pakistani Weddings: From the Nikkah to the reception, a skilled photographer will be able to frame these spiritual moments.
Bengali Weddings: The Pre-wedding turmeric ceremony and Bidaai ceremonies carry profound sentimental value, requiring expert documentation.
A photographer well-versed in South Asian traditions will be aware of these ceremonies and prepared to capture them at the perfect time.
Adapting to Lively Settings
Asian weddings are filled with energy, from the groom’s lively Baraat procession to the exciting dance performances at the music celebration. Capturing these moments requires a photographer who can efficiently adapt to varied lighting conditions, crowded venues, and fast-paced celebrations.
Immortalizing Spontaneous Expressions
While posed portraits are important, the best wedding photographs often come from natural moments—happy tears during the Bidaai, laughter shared between siblings, or the bride’s anticipation before the nuptials. A expert photographer will have an eye for these unrehearsed emotions and immortalize them flawlessly.
What to Expect from an Asian Wedding Photographer in Birmingham
A professional South Asian wedding photography service offers much more than just taking pictures. Here’s what you can expect when working with a professional photographer:
1. Pre-Wedding Consultation
Before the wedding, your photographer will arrange a meeting to discuss your requirements, important moments, and strategize their coverage. This ensures they don’t miss any important moments.
2. Pre-Wedding Shoots
Many couples opt for pre-wedding photoshoots in stunning locations around Birmingham, Asian Wedding Photography Birmingham such as:
• Birmingham Botanical Gardens
• Cannon Hill Park
• Aston Hall
• Modern Cityscape Views
These sessions allow partners to become comfortable in front of the camera before the big day.
3. High-Quality Photography & Editing
Professional photographers use top-quality cameras and lenses to ensure sharp, high-resolution images. Additionally, expert editing enhances the final photos by adjusting lighting, colors, and clarity while preserving natural beauty.
4. A Mix of Traditional and Modern Styles
The best wedding photographers combine classic formal photographs with creative and photojournalistic images. Expect a mix of:
• Elegant group shots
• Spontaneous moments of genuine expressions
• Stylized bride and groom portraits with dramatic lighting
• Documentary-style images capturing cultural rituals
5. Videography Services
Many photography packages include cinematic films, allowing couples to experience their memorable day through beautifully edited videos and extended footage.
